Burgundy snails and woodpeckers also occur in our garden; the latter like to use one of my favourite trees - a robinia that we grew from a seed - as a woodpecker's smithy. I haven't found any proper translation of the German term "Spechtschmiede", but I hope you know what I mean: A place where the woodpecker fixes, for instance, a pine-cone in order to peck out the seeds. The branchings of the robinia seem to have just the right angle for that. :)

Oh BTW, something else I love about this weather: It seems to intensify the colours of the plants. Apples, for instance, need cool nights and sunny days in order to get intensely red. I think I've read somewhere that this weather also intensifies the autumn colours of the leaves. Finally I'm convinced that late summer sunshine makes flowers more intense.
